The full casting has been announced for the 50th anniversary production of rock musical Hair, which runs at the Vaults from October.

Hair is the story of the "tribe" a political group of hippies living in New York protesting against the Vietnam War. It has music by Galt McDermot, lyrics and a book by James Rado and Gerome Ragni, and first opened Off-Broadway in 1967. It features the songs "Aquarius", "Let the Sun Shine In" and "Good Morning Star Shine."

The cast of the musical includes Shekina McFarlane (The Lion King) as Claude, Daniel Bailey (Motown the Musical) as his friend Berger and Natalie Green (Wicked) as roommate Sheila. The characters Claude and Berger were autobiographical, based on Rado and Ragni respectively.

They will be joined by Adam Dawson (West Side Story), Andy Coxon (Yank!), Patrick George (Cats), Jammy Kasongo (Beautiful), Jessie May (Rock of Ages), Laura Johnson (Grease), Robert Metson, Liam Ross-Mills (Les Miserables), Koryann Stevens (West Side Story) and Kirsten Wright.

Hair runs at The Vaults from 4th October to 13th January, with an official opening on 11th October. It has also been announced that a 'clothing optional' performance will take place on 11th November, where the audience will be invited to watch the show naked, if they so wish.

This production opened at the Hope Mill Theatre in Manchester last year, and will transform the London venue into an immersive, psychedelic Woodstock-esque experience with a special pop-up restaurant and themed drinks before the show starts.

It is directed by Jonathan O'Boyle who has acted as an assistant director on An American in Paris at the Dominion Theatre and directed The Scottsboro Boys at the Young Vic and in the West End.
